Transaction 966761d0b682159871248976362b960b107ceb551b6633e856d635a41fe45786

1 Input
2 Outputs
  • 966761d0b682159871248976362b960b107ceb551b6633e856d635a41fe45786:0
  • value  2814740
    address  17whYBxuaayadaTHtdCR6i1qLqratLQnHn
  • 966761d0b682159871248976362b960b107ceb551b6633e856d635a41fe45786:1
  • value  69292
    address  bc1qw9rqg4q73u8he0k28napgy9fx00vklh6fjtgyj